Digital Imaging and Communications of Medicine (DICOM) has become a world-wide standard. Picture Archiving and Communication system (PACS), based on DICOM standard, has also become one of infrastructures of information in medical organizations, which has been playing a more and more significant role in the field of clinical diagnosis, researching and teaching in medicine, teletherapy and so on.DICOM mainly includes the definitions of data structure and transmission specification of digital medical imaging. It aims at the targets of implementing communication and share of medical imaging without obstacles between different systems, and of realizing interconnection and interoperability among varied medical modalities and medical information management systems.Many kinds of modern information technologies are used in PACS, which follows DICOM standard and implements acquisition, storage, administration, communication, sharing and occurs of medical imaging. The realization of "filmless" in hospital, sharing and utilizing resources of medical imaging fully is the goal of PACS. Especially its central function is archiving images and controlling data transmission.Nuclear medicine imaging is a way in which organic shapes, physiological and metabolic functions can be acquired and reflected through detecting distribution of radionuclide after radiopharmaceuticals is injected into human body. It is the most optimum image modality at molecular level presently, except the considerable defect of its relatively low space resolution. When PACS is constructed in Department of Nuclear Medicine, Registration and fusion of multi-modal images can be achieved. Then disadvantages of nuclear medicine imaging will be overcome and its unique advantages will be extended. This is just the objective of this dissertation.At first, the core of DICOM 3.0 is analyzed in detail in the dissertation, including oriented object definitions of information unit and function unit, encoded mode, hierarchy information model, architecture of network, parsing of image file, communication model based on C/S architecture and so on. These are keys to understanding DICOM. These are also foundation stone of developing PACS.
